Schmidt Sent to Disabled List; Oaks Transferred to Jacksonville

JACKSONVILLE, Fla. - The Jacksonville Suns, Double-A minor league affiliate of the Miami Marlins, announced today that RHP Joshua Schmidt has been sent to the 7-day disabled list, retroactive to June 24. In a corresponding move, RHP Alan Oaks has been transferred from Jupiter to Jacksonville. .

Schmidt heads to the 7-day disabled list with a right quad strain. In 26 appearances with the Suns 2012, Schmidt recorded a 2-3 record with a 3.68 ERA.

Oaks, who heads to Jacksonville from Jupiter, is making his first appearance in Jacksonville. Oaks was 1-2 with a 6.17 ERA in 17 appearances with the Hammerheads and struck out 30 batters while walking 15.

The Suns roster remains at the maximum of 25 allowed by the Southern League.
